American morbidity: gap between lifespan and healthspan keeps widening

Clinical takeaway: The conditions driving unhealthy years, obesity, low back pain, depression and anxiety, hearing loss, and falls, are core primary care territory. This puts prevention and long-term management at the center of healthy aging.
Longevity gains have long been expected to happen alongside healthier aging. Instead, the opposite has been happening almost everywhere around the world. In 203 out of 204 countries, life expectancy grew faster than healthy life expectancy between 1990 and 2023.
The US now has the widest gap in the world, with Americans averaging 14 years in poor health, nearly 18% of their lives. And rather than piling up toward the end of life when people are elderly, those unhealthy years accumulate over time across the adult lifespan.
The finding lands squarely within what is a decades-old debate. A "compression of morbidity" hypothesis dating from at least 1980 has held that better prevention and care would delay disability more than death, so illness would crowd into a brief window before dying. This new Global Burden of Disease (GBD) analysis is the broadest test of that idea yet, and it found the reverse. The global gap grew to 10.7 years in 2023 from 8.8 in 1990, with 14.5% of life now spent in poor health.
In high-income countries like the US, most of the unhealthy years come from a handful of mostly non-fatal conditions. Musculoskeletal and mental disorders alone make up more than a third of the high-income world's 12.7-year gap. Unintentional injuries, neurological disorders, and hearing and vision loss bring the total to 61.8%. The global pattern is similar, led by low back pain, depression and anxiety, age-related hearing loss, and falls, at 57.4% of unhealthy years.
Women lived longer than men everywhere but spent more of those years in poor health, 12.1 versus 9.3 in 2023. The gaps for both sexes have grown at nearly the same pace since 1990, when women stood at 10.0 years and men at 7.6. Musculoskeletal disorders and mental health conditions disproportionately affect women, the authors note.
The leading risk factors are familiar to primary care: high fasting plasma glucose, high BMI, and tobacco use. In high-income countries, high BMI is the leading contributor. Low bone mineral density, dietary risks, and high systolic blood pressure also rank highly. Drug and alcohol use registered as notable contributors only in high-income settings. In lower-income countries the profile shifts, with child and maternal malnutrition and air pollution becoming leading contributing factors.
Researchers calculated the morbidity gap, life expectancy minus healthy life expectancy, for 204 countries and territories using GBD 2023 estimates spanning 1990 to 2023, then split it by cause, risk factor, sex, and development level. Contributions were based on years lived with disability, adjusted so overlapping conditions were not counted twice.
With high BMI and high fasting plasma glucose topping the risk list in high-income countries, the obvious question is now: what will the introduction of GLP-1s and their ilk mean for population health over time? The morbidity gap is a chronic disease problem, so tools that rein in its leading metabolic drivers could shift the story again in the coming decades.
"Improving healthy aging will require greater focus on the conditions and risk factors that drive years lived with disability. Addressing these earlier through prevention and better long-term care could have meaningful social, health system, and economic impacts," said said Catherine Bisignano, MPH, senior scientific writer at the Institute for Health Metrics and Evaluation and co-author of the study.
